Embodiment 1

[0042] A kind of processing technology of broken ganoderma lucidum spore powder, this processing technology comprises the steps:

[0043] P1, choose the ganoderma lucidum spore powder raw material, set aside;

[0044] P2. Put the spare raw materials in clean water, soak and clean them, and stir evenly for 20 minutes to 30 minutes at a rate of 25 rpm to 35 rpm to obtain the cleaning raw materials;

[0045] P3. Put the cleaning raw material into a plastic container, and cook it at 100°C to 110°C to obtain the cooking raw material;

[0046] P4, naturally cooling the cooking raw material to 70-80 degrees Celsius, and then immersing it in liquid nitrogen for rapid cooling to obtain the cooling raw material;

[0047] P5. Melt the cooling raw material in a water bath at 40°C to 50°C, then perform rapid cooling again, and cycle three times to obtain the melted raw material;

[0048] P6, adding sodium chloride particles in the melted raw material to obtain mixed raw material;

Abstract

The invention discloses a processing technology of wall-broken glossy ganoderma tritici. The processing technology comprises the following steps of P1, selecting glossy ganoderma tritici raw materials; P2, obtaining cleaned raw materials; P3, obtaining cooked raw materials; P4, obtaining cooled raw materials; P5, obtaining molten raw materials; P6, obtaining mixed raw materials; P7, obtaining treated raw materials; P8, performing filtering to remove a solution to obtain wall-broken raw materials; and P9, drying the wall-broken raw materials to complete processing of the tritici, cooking and softening the tritici raw materials, then performing repeated liquid nitrogen freezing operation, treating spore walls through rapid thermal expansion and contraction characteristics, and then performing ultrasonic treatment by mixing sodium chloride particles, so that filtration and removal are convenient, and mixing is avoided. Besides, the wall breaking rate and treatment efficiency are effectively improved, the product quality is guaranteed, processing is convenient, and application and popularization are facilitated.

Description

technical field [0001] The invention relates to the technical field of spore powder processing, in particular to a processing technology of wall-broken ganoderma spore powder. Background technique [0002] The surface of Ganoderma lucidum spore powder has two layers of walls, the main components are glucose and chitin, and there are uniformly distributed holes on the surface of the cell wall. The wall of Ganoderma lucidum spore powder is very hard and extremely difficult to be oxidized and decomposed. Untreated spore powder will To limit the body's utilization of it, the spore powder is usually broken to make full use of the effective substances in the spores.
